Jones Bridge River Station Pool Comes Alive with Piranhas and Barracudas
Weekly summer swim meets in Peachtree Corners filled with swimmers of all ages.
The starting horn sounded, the flash fired and the water erupted with Piranhas and Barracudas at the River Station Pool under a carnival atmosphere akin to a summer festival complete with vendors and tents. There were foods to eat, drinks to drink and of course, friendly competitive swimming events involving children as young as five years old and up to seventeen.Β
Team events began with the 25 yard backstroke for girls 6 and under, followed by the boys and moving on up through the 100 and 200 yard medley relays, then freestyle swimming competitions, individual medleys, breaststroke and butterfly heats in every age range.
